在现代科技高度发达的今天,计算器已经成为我们日常生活中不可或缺的工具,无论是学生、工程师、科学家还是普通消费者,计算器都以其快速、准确的特性赢得了广泛的信任,尽管计算器在大多数情况下能够提供精确的结果,但在某些情况下,计算器也会出现误差,计算器误差为什么存在?本文将从多个角度深入探讨计算器误差的来源与影响。
一、计算器误差的定义与分类
计算器误差是指计算器在运算过程中产生的与真实值之间的偏差,根据误差的性质和来源,计算器误差可以分为以下几类:
1、系统误差:系统误差是由于计算器硬件或软件设计上的缺陷导致的误差,这种误差通常是固定的,可以通过校准或改进设计来减少或消除。
2、随机误差:随机误差是由于计算器内部电子元件的噪声、温度变化等不可控因素引起的误差,这种误差通常是随机的,难以完全消除。
3、截断误差:截断误差是由于计算器在进行数值计算时,无法精确表示无限小数或无限级数,只能进行有限位数的截断而产生的误差。
4、舍入误差:舍入误差是由于计算器在进行数值计算时,对结果进行四舍五入而产生的误差,这种误差在连续运算中可能会累积,导致最终结果的偏差。
二、计算器误差的来源
1、硬件限制:计算器的硬件设计决定了其运算精度,现代计算器通常采用二进制浮点数表示法,这种表示法在表示某些十进制小数时存在精度限制,0.1在二进制中是一个无限循环小数,计算器只能对其进行近似表示,从而导致误差。
2、软件算法:计算器的软件算法也会影响其运算精度,不同的算法在处理相同问题时,可能会产生不同的误差,计算器在进行三角函数计算时,通常会使用泰勒级数展开或查表法,这些方法在特定范围内可能产生较大的误差。
3、环境因素:计算器的运算精度还受到环境因素的影响,温度变化可能导致计算器内部电子元件的性能发生变化,从而影响运算精度,电磁干扰也可能导致计算器产生随机误差。
4、用户操作:用户在使用计算器时,也可能引入误差,用户在输入数据时可能输入错误,或者在选择运算模式时选择不当,这些都可能导致计算器产生误差。
三、计算器误差的影响
1、科学计算:在科学计算中,计算器误差可能导致实验结果的不准确,在物理实验中,计算器误差可能导致测量值与理论值之间的偏差,从而影响实验结论的可靠性。
2、工程设计:在工程设计中,计算器误差可能导致设计参数的不准确,在建筑设计中,计算器误差可能导致结构强度的计算不准确,从而影响建筑的安全性。
3、金融计算:在金融计算中,计算器误差可能导致财务数据的不准确,在投资计算中,计算器误差可能导致投资收益的计算不准确,从而影响投资决策。
4、教育领域:在教育领域,计算器误差可能导致学生理解上的偏差,在数学教学中,计算器误差可能导致学生对某些数学概念的理解不准确,从而影响学习效果。
四、减少计算器误差的方法
1、选择高精度计算器:选择具有高精度运算能力的计算器,可以有效减少计算器误差,选择支持更高位数浮点数运算的计算器,可以减少截断误差和舍入误差。
2、优化算法:优化计算器的软件算法,可以提高运算精度,采用更精确的数值积分算法或更高效的数值求解方法,可以减少系统误差和截断误差。
3、环境控制:在使用计算器时,尽量控制环境因素,减少温度变化和电磁干扰对计算器运算精度的影响。
4、用户培训:对用户进行培训,提高其使用计算器的技能,可以减少用户操作引入的误差,培训用户正确输入数据、选择合适的运算模式等。
计算器误差的存在是多种因素共同作用的结果,尽管现代计算器在大多数情况下能够提供精确的结果,但在某些情况下,计算器误差仍然不可避免,了解计算器误差的来源与影响,采取相应的措施减少误差,对于提高计算器的使用效果具有重要意义,在未来,随着计算器技术的不断进步,我们有理由相信,计算器误差将会得到进一步的控制和减少,为我们的生活和工作带来更多的便利和准确性。
通过本文的探讨,我们不仅了解了计算器误差的存在原因,还掌握了减少误差的方法,希望这些知识能够帮助读者在使用计算器时更加得心应手,避免因误差而导致的错误和损失。